Inline quantum-well waveguide photodetectors for the measurement of wavelength shifts
Abstract
A two-segment GaAs-InGaP-InGaAs p-i-n quantum-well waveguide photodiode has been fabricated and demonstrated to function as a sensitive wavelength monitor. The ratio of the two segments' photocurrents varies linearly with wavelength in a region near the absorption band edge.
